Software Payment Recovery in India: Legal Remedies for Unpaid Invoices
In India’s thriving software development sector, delayed or unpaid invoices are a persistent challenge for IT firms, freelancers, and developers. This comprehensive 2025 guide from eVaakil.com is your definitive legal and strategic roadmap to navigate payment recovery. We’ll explore powerful tools like the MSME Samadhaan portal, the strategic use of a legal notice, fast-track summary suits, and even the Insolvency and Bankruptcy Code (IBC) for significant undisputed dues. From crafting ironclad contracts to leveraging our interactive decision tree and pre-action checklist, this article provides the actionable steps you need to secure your hard-earned revenue.
Software Payment Recovery in India
A Complete Legal and Strategic Guide (Updated till Sept 2025)
In the fast-paced world of software development in India, one of the most persistent and frustrating challenges for developers, freelancers, and IT firms is the delay or non-payment of dues. This guide, updated for 2025, serves as your comprehensive legal and strategic roadmap to navigate this complex issue, ensuring you get paid for your hard work.
In This Guide:
- Section 1: Understanding the Battlefield
- Section 1.5: The Shield of Prevention: Crafting Ironclad Contracts
- Section 2: The First Line of Defence: Your Invoice
- Section 3: Are You an MSME? The Game-Changing Advantage
- Section 3.5: The Diplomat's Gambit: Pre-Litigation Strategy
- Section 4: The 45-Day Rule: A Ticking Clock for Your Client
- Section 5: A Guide to the MSME Samadhaan Portal
- Section 6: The Legal Arsenal: Choosing Your Weapon
- Section 7: Remedy Comparison: Which Path Is Right for You?
- Section 7.2: Decision Tree: Find Your Best Legal Path
- Section 7.5: The Arbitrator's Table: A Closer Look at Arbitration
- Section 8: A Deeper Dive into Legal Remedies
- Section 8.5: The Nuclear Option: Insolvency & Bankruptcy Code (IBC)
- Section 9: The Power of Evidence
- Crossing Borders: Recovering Dues from International Clients
- Section 10: Strategic Pathways for Payment Recovery
- Section 10.5: War Stories: Real-World Scenarios & Outcomes
- Section 11: Conclusion and Key Takeaways
- Section 12: Ask the eVaakil: Frequently Asked Questions (FAQ)
Section 1: Understanding the Battlefield
Payment delays aren't just an inconvenience; they cripple cash flow, halt projects, and can even threaten the survival of small firms and freelancers. The reasons for delay are often varied, ranging from genuine client-side financial issues to deliberate tactics to avoid payment. Understanding the common patterns is the first step toward building a robust recovery strategy.
Common Excuses for Payment Delays
"Scope Creep" Dispute
Client claims work was done outside the original agreement.
Client Cash Flow Issues
The client is facing financial difficulties and prioritizes other payments.
"Unmet" Quality Standards
Vague claims of bugs or dissatisfaction with the final product.
Section 1.5: The Shield of Prevention: Crafting Ironclad Contracts
The best way to win a payment dispute is to prevent it from ever happening. Your contract or Statement of Work (SOW) is not just a formality; it's your primary shield and sword. A well-drafted agreement minimizes ambiguity and sets clear expectations for both parties.
Anatomy of a Bulletproof Software Contract
Detailed Scope of Work (SOW):
Precisely define deliverables, features, and functionalities. Include what is NOT included to prevent scope creep.
Clear Payment Milestones:
Link payments to specific, measurable progress (e.g., 25% on UI/UX completion, 50% on backend completion, 25% on final deployment). Avoid vague terms.
Acceptance Criteria:
Define how and when a milestone is considered "complete." Specify a testing period (e.g., 5 business days) after which the work is deemed accepted if no issues are reported.
Late Payment Penalties:
Specify an interest rate for delayed payments (e.g., 1.5% per month) as permitted by law. This incentivizes timely payment.
Dispute Resolution & Jurisdiction:
Clearly state that any disputes will be subject to arbitration or the courts in a specific city (e.g., "Courts of Kolkata shall have exclusive jurisdiction"). This avoids costly arguments later.
Section 2: The First Line of Defence: Your Invoice
An invoice isn't just a request for payment; it's a legal document. A professionally crafted, detailed invoice strengthens your position and can be a crucial piece of evidence. Ensure every invoice you send is clear, complete, and correct.
Section 3: Are You an MSME? The Game-Changing Advantage
The Micro, Small and Medium Enterprises Development (MSMED) Act, 2006, is one of the most powerful tools available to software developers and small IT firms in India. If your firm qualifies and is registered as an MSME, you gain access to a special, expedited legal framework for payment recovery.
Check Your MSME Status
Under the revised definition, your status depends on a composite criteria of investment and turnover.
Micro
Investment ≤ ₹1 Cr & Turnover ≤ ₹5 Cr
Small
Investment ≤ ₹10 Cr & Turnover ≤ ₹50 Cr
Medium
Investment ≤ ₹50 Cr & Turnover ≤ ₹250 Cr
Section 3.5: The Diplomat's Gambit: Pre-Litigation Strategy
Before escalating to legal action, a structured, professional communication strategy can often resolve payment issues. This approach not only saves time and money but also helps preserve business relationships where possible. Maintain a clear, documented trail at every stage.
The Escalation Ladder: From Reminder to Legal Notice
Step 1: The Gentle Reminder
A polite email sent 1-2 days after the due date. Assume it's an oversight.
Step 2: The Firm Follow-Up
Sent 7-10 days past due. Directly ask for a payment status update and reference the invoice number.
Step 3: The Final Demand
Sent 20-25 days past due. State that failure to pay by a specific date will lead to escalation. Mention late fees if applicable.
Step 4: The Legal Notice
A formal notice drafted by a lawyer. This is a final warning before initiating legal proceedings and shows you are serious.
Section 4: The 45-Day Rule: A Ticking Clock for Your Client
Section 15 of the MSMED Act is its beating heart. It mandates that a buyer must make payment to a Micro or Small Enterprise for goods or services rendered on or before the agreed date. If there is no agreement, the payment must be made within 45 days of the acceptance of services.
The 45-Day Countdown
Begins from day 46
The Hammer of Penal Interest: A buyer who misses the 45-day deadline is liable to pay compound interest with monthly rests at three times the RBI's bank rate. This creates a massive financial liability for the defaulter.
Section 5: A Guide to the MSME Samadhaan Portal
The MSME Samadhaan is an online portal operated by the Ministry of MSME where enterprises can file an application regarding delayed payments. This filing is then forwarded to the Micro and Small Enterprise Facilitation Council (MSEFC) in your state, which has the power of a civil court to resolve the dispute.
Section 6: The Legal Arsenal: Choosing Your Weapon
If you are not an MSME or choose not to use the Samadhaan portal, the Indian legal system offers several other remedies. The right choice depends on the amount of the debt, the available evidence, and your budget for legal costs.
Section 7: Remedy Comparison: Which Path Is Right for You?
Navigating the legal options can be daunting. This interactive table helps you compare the key remedies based on factors that matter most to you.
Interactive Comparison of Legal Remedies
Remedy | Best For | Speed | Cost |
---|---|---|---|
MSME Samadhaan | Registered MSMEs with clear documentation. | Very Fast (90-180 days) | Very Low (Free Filing) |
Summary Suit | Undisputed debts with written proof (email, contract). | Fast (6-12 months) | Medium (Court Fees) |
Civil Recovery Suit | Complex disputes, oral contracts, or disputed quality. | Slow (2-5+ years) | High |
Arbitration | Contracts with a pre-existing arbitration clause. | Fast (6-12 months) | High (Arbitrator Fees) |
Insolvency (IBC) | Undisputed debts over ₹1 Crore against a company. | Very Fast (Often settles in weeks) | Medium to High |
Section 7.2: Decision Tree: Find Your Best Legal Path
Feeling overwhelmed by the options? This decision tree provides a simplified, step-by-step visual guide to help you identify the most strategic legal route based on your specific situation.
Start Here: Your Payment Recovery Journey
Your invoice is overdue. What's the first critical question?
Is the undisputed debt against a company and over ₹1 Crore?
Your strongest weapon is the IBC.
File a demand notice under the Insolvency & Bankruptcy Code. The threat of insolvency often leads to immediate payment.
Are you registered as an MSME on the Udyam portal?
Use the MSME Samadhaan Portal.
This is your most cost-effective and fastest route. The high penal interest for the defaulter is a powerful incentive for them to settle.
Do you have a written contract, invoice, or a clear written admission of debt (e.g., email)?
File a Summary Suit (Order XXXVII).
This is a fast-track court procedure. The client must prove they have a strong defense just to be heard, saving you time.
File a standard Civil Recovery Suit.
This is the default option for disputed claims or oral contracts. Be prepared for a longer timeline as you will need to prove your case with evidence.
Section 7.5: The Arbitrator's Table: A Closer Look at Arbitration
Arbitration is a form of alternative dispute resolution (ADR) where a neutral third party (the arbitrator) hears both sides and makes a decision that is legally binding. For many software development disputes, it is a more efficient path than traditional court proceedings, provided an arbitration clause exists in your contract.
✅ Pros of Arbitration
- Speed: Significantly faster than courts, often resolving in months instead of years.
- Expertise: You can choose an arbitrator with tech industry knowledge.
- Confidentiality: Proceedings are private, protecting your business reputation.
- Finality: The arbitrator's decision (award) is final and binding, with limited grounds for appeal.
❌ Cons of Arbitration
- Cost: Can be expensive upfront as you pay the arbitrator's fees.
- No Clause, No Go: Requires a pre-existing arbitration agreement in your contract.
- Limited Appeal: If you disagree with the outcome, it's very difficult to challenge.
The Process in a Nutshell:
- Invoke the Clause: Send a formal notice to the other party invoking the arbitration clause.
- Appoint an Arbitrator: Both parties agree on a neutral arbitrator. If they can't agree, a court may appoint one.
- Pleadings & Evidence: Both sides submit their claims, defenses, and evidence.
- Hearing: A formal (but less rigid than court) hearing takes place.
- The Award: The arbitrator delivers a final, written, and binding decision.
Section 8: A Deeper Dive into Legal Remedies
Each legal path has its own nuances, procedures, and strategic considerations. Here’s a closer look at what each entails.
Section 8.5: The Nuclear Option: Using the Insolvency and Bankruptcy Code (IBC), 2016
For larger, undisputed debts, the IBC has emerged as one of the most powerful recovery tools in India. It is not a recovery suit in the traditional sense; rather, it is a process to initiate corporate insolvency against a defaulting company. The mere threat of losing control of their company often compels debtors to pay up immediately.
Key Condition: The IBC can be invoked by an operational creditor (like a software firm) for an undisputed debt of over ₹1 crore.
The IBC Trigger: A Creditor's Flowchart
Step 1: Default Occurs
Undisputed invoice(s) totalling > ₹1 crore are unpaid.
Step 2: Send Demand Notice (Form 3 or 4)
A formal notice is sent demanding payment within 10 days.
Step 3: Wait for 10 Days
Two possible outcomes...
Outcome A: Payment Received
The debtor pays the amount to avoid insolvency proceedings. The process ends.
Outcome B: No Payment / No Valid Dispute
The debtor fails to pay or raise a pre-existing, valid dispute.
Step 4: File Application with NCLT
File a petition with the National Company Law Tribunal to initiate insolvency.
Format Template: Filing the NCLT Application (Form NCLT-9)
While the application must be filed by a legal professional, understanding its components is crucial. Here’s a template of the key information you'll need to provide for an application under Section 9 of the IBC.
Key Components of the Application
Part I: Particulars of Operational Creditor
- Name, Identification Number (CIN/LLPIN), and Address.
- Date of incorporation/registration.
- Details of the authorized representative.
Part II: Particulars of Corporate Debtor (Your Client)
- Name, Identification Number (CIN), and Registered Address.
- Capital structure and shareholding details (if known).
Part III: Particulars of Proposed Interim Resolution Professional
- Name, Address, and Registration Number of the proposed insolvency professional.
- (Note: You must propose a qualified professional to manage the process).
Part IV: Particulars of Operational Debt
- Total Amount of Debt: ₹ [Total Amount]
- Principal Amount: ₹ [Principal] | Interest: ₹ [Interest, if any]
- Date(s) on which the debt became due.
- Detailed computation of the claim (attach as an annexure).
Part V: Documents, Records, and Evidence of Default
- Attach a copy of the Demand Notice (Form 3 or 4) sent to the debtor.
- Proof of service of the Demand Notice (e.g., courier receipts, email delivery reports).
- Copies of all relevant invoices and purchase orders.
- Copy of the signed contract or agreement.
- Copies of relevant email correspondence admitting the debt or confirming work.
- An affidavit stating that no notice of dispute was received from the debtor.
- A copy of your company's bank statement showing no payment was received.
Section 9: The Power of Evidence
Regardless of the path you choose, the outcome will hinge on the quality of your evidence. A strong documentary trail is your greatest asset.
- The Contract/Agreement: The foundational document outlining the scope, payment terms, and deliverables.
- Invoices: Clean, professional, and timely invoices for every payment milestone.
- Email Correspondence: A complete record of communication, especially any admission of debt or approval of work.
- Project Management Records: Data from tools like Jira, Trello, or Asana showing progress and completion.
- Proof of Delivery: Server logs, app store links, or handover documents proving the software was delivered.
- Witness Testimony: Statements from employees or collaborators who worked on the project.
Section 9.5: Crossing Borders: Recovering Dues from International Clients
The global nature of the software industry means many Indian firms serve clients abroad. Recovering payments from international clients presents unique challenges, but it is far from impossible with the right contractual safeguards.
The Challenges
- Jurisdiction: Which country's laws apply?
- Enforcement: An Indian court order may be difficult to enforce in the USA or UK.
- High Costs: International litigation is prohibitively expensive.
The Solutions (Set in the Contract!)
- Clear Jurisdiction Clause: Explicitly state that Indian courts will have jurisdiction. While enforcement is hard, it gives you a legal judgment.
- International Arbitration: Agree to arbitration in a neutral, business-friendly location like Singapore (SIAC) or London (LCIA). The awards from these bodies are enforceable in most countries under the New York Convention.
- Advance Payments & Milestones: Structure payments to minimize your exposure. Always take a significant advance before starting work.
- Use of Escrow Services: For larger projects, use a trusted third-party escrow service that holds the client's funds and releases them upon milestone completion.
Section 10: Strategic Pathways for Payment Recovery
This flowchart helps visualize the decision-making process for recovering your dues, starting from the moment a payment is late.
Interactive Chart: Remedy Timelines
Hover over the bars to see typical resolution timelines.
Section 10.5: War Stories: Real-World Scenarios & Outcomes
Theory is one thing, but seeing how these remedies apply in practice provides valuable insight. Here are a few anonymized scenarios based on common cases.
Scenario 1: The Freelance Developer vs. The Startup
Debt: ₹2.5 Lakhs | Issue: Startup client delayed final payment, citing minor bugs.
Action Taken: The developer, having an MSME Udyam registration, first sent a final demand email referencing the MSMED Act. When the startup failed to respond, he filed a case on the MSME Samadhaan portal.
Outcome: The Micro and Small Enterprise Facilitation Council (MSEFC) initiated conciliation. Faced with the prospect of paying 3x the RBI bank rate as penal interest, the startup settled the full amount within 60 days of the filing.
Scenario 2: The Mid-Size IT Firm vs. The Manufacturing Company
Debt: ₹40 Lakhs | Issue: Client disputed the quality of a custom ERP system and refused to pay the final 50% milestone.
Action Taken: The contract had a clear arbitration clause. The IT firm invoked arbitration. Both parties presented technical evidence and expert testimony to an arbitrator with a software background.
Outcome: The arbitrator found that while the IT firm had delivered 90% of the promised scope, some minor features were missing. The award directed the client to pay ₹35 Lakhs (deducting a value for the undelivered work). The entire process was completed in 7 months, far quicker than a civil suit.
Scenario 3: The Enterprise Software Co. vs. The Large Corporate
Debt: ₹1.2 Crores | Issue: The corporate client simply refused to clear long-pending, undisputed invoices due to their own internal financial mismanagement.
Action Taken: After a formal legal notice went unanswered, the software company's lawyers sent a Demand Notice under the Insolvency and Bankruptcy Code (IBC).
Outcome: The threat of being dragged to the NCLT and having an Interim Resolution Professional take over their company management was immense. The corporate client's finance team immediately contacted the software company and cleared the entire outstanding amount within 8 days of receiving the notice.
Section 11: Conclusion and Key Takeaways
Delayed payments are a serious challenge, but you are not powerless. The Indian legal framework, particularly the MSMED Act, provides strong protections. The key is to be proactive, strategic, and meticulous in your approach.
Final Checklist for Success
- Prevention First: Draft ironclad contracts with clear payment terms and penalties.
- Document Everything: Your email trail is your best evidence.
- Get MSME Registered: The Udyam registration is your superpower.
- Act Fast: Don't let debts linger. Start the communication process early.
- Know Your Options: Understand the difference between a summary suit, civil suit, and the IBC.
- Leverage Your Status: If you are an MSME, the Samadhaan portal is your most potent, cost-effective tool.
Section 12: Ask the eVaakil: Frequently Asked Questions (FAQ)
While a written contract is strongly advised, you can still recover your dues. An oral agreement is legally valid, but harder to prove. Your case will depend on evidence like email correspondence, WhatsApp chats, project management tool records (like Jira/Trello), proof of partial payments, and the final delivered product itself. The totality of this evidence can establish the terms of the agreement and your right to payment.
Costs vary significantly based on the path you choose.
- MSME Samadhaan: Filing is free. You only need a lawyer if you choose to have representation during the proceedings.
- Summary Suit: Requires a court fee, which is a percentage of the claim amount and varies by state. Lawyer's fees are additional.
- Arbitration: Can be expensive as you must pay the arbitrator's fees, which can be substantial for large claims, in addition to your lawyer's fees.
- IBC Filing: The NCLT filing fee is relatively low, but professional fees for the lawyer/firm handling the case can be significant.
Yes, in most legal proceedings, you can claim your legal costs as part of the relief sought. However, the court or arbitrator has the final discretion on whether to award costs and the amount. It is not always guaranteed that you will recover 100% of your actual expenses. The MSMED Act specifically provides for the recovery of interest, but costs are still at the council's discretion.
Yes. As per GST law, interest, late fees, or penalties for delayed payment of consideration for any supply are includible in the value of supply and are subject to GST. The GST rate would be the same as the rate applicable to the original service provided (e.g., 18% for most software services). You would need to issue a debit note to the client for this amount.